Protein Description

LYPD4 (Ly6/PLAUR domain-containing protein 4) is a member of the Ly6 protein family, which plays crucial roles in various biological processes, including cell adhesion, immune response, and neuronal function. The study of LYPD4 has gained significant attention due to its potential implications in cancer biology and autoimmune diseases. It is primarily expressed in immune cells and has been linked to the modulation of T cell function and the regulation of inflammatory responses. Recent research has suggested that LYPD4 might act as a novel immune checkpoint, influencing tumor microenvironments and potentially serving as a therapeutic target in cancer treatment. Moreover, understanding the structure and function of LYPD4 could illuminate its role in facilitating cell-cell interactions and signaling pathways that are essential for immune regulation.
